Ensuring Accessibility and Affordability
Affordable Housing focuses on making homes accessible without placing an undue financial burden on residents. Affordable housing options are typically priced in such a way that residents do not spend more than a set percentage of their income on housing costs. By offering lower rent or mortgage payments, these homes make it possible for people to live comfortably without sacrificing essential needs like food, healthcare, and education.

Variety in Housing Options
Affordable Housing comes in a variety of forms to meet the needs of diverse populations. From single-family homes and apartments to co-op housing and multi-family units, there are different models available depending on location, budget, and family size. The variety in housing options ensures that people from all walks of life can find a living situation that fits their needs and preferences.
